Output 2acb327f9adf93bedf02b4afa7ace7804e04050737eb792fcb0efbeb8522e901:51

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f88ce124e1243532a01946e428a1cc37f1c058 OP_EQUAL
address
3MepywY9TR6kQAmm9JLbjbBFREpBeiz2gM
transaction
2acb327f9adf93bedf02b4afa7ace7804e04050737eb792fcb0efbeb8522e901
spent
true